So far no solid numbers yet, except I spent $1,000 for a pair of bare Gen IV heads, shipped to Greg Good ($500 each), and $1725 for ARH 1 7/8 race tube 5 into 1 headers with Gen IV flanges (headers are not included in the MoPar pkg). I expect the porting and custom valve sizes from Greg to be in the $3,000 range, then add for rocker arms. A custom Hogan sheet metal intake is $3,300, but I think JMB is going to beat that price. I will be adding a custom solid roller cam. Remember the Mopar pkg is only heads (complete) and intake (no TB) plus tuning......no headers, no cam, unported heads, unported intake.........my heads will outflow the stock ones, my intake will outflow the stock one....so for the same basic price I feel I will be way ahead. I also will be rebuilding the block (forged rods and 11 to 1 pistons, plus improved oiling and a keyed crank), along with a custom Chris Jensen tune....so I fully expect to be between 650 and 700 rwhp.:rock:

Update time! Just spoke with Greg Good and I have the preliminary flow numbers on the Gen IV heads. I think my Gen III stock heads flow between 268-280 cfm @ .600 on the intake side. Here are the numbers for the Gen IV ported heads:

LIFT.......INTAKE.......EXHAUST FLOW
.200........165...........115
.300........254...........178
.400........309...........220
.500........348...........244
.600........369...........258
.700........375...........259
.750........377...........260

Greg is calling Justin @ JMB today with the specs for the custom intake, he wants total runner length(runner and port) of 15", round runner shape, 25% taper on the runners, and have the runners extend up into the plenum chamber. More details to follow.

The cam specs we are considering are 248-256 with .700 lift, 114 LSA, Solid roller.

The valve sizes on the new heads are: 2.170 intake and 1.600 exhaust.

Just got off the phone with Justin, and after talking with Greg Good, they decided that I might best use the Gen IV lower manifold with the Challenger Drag Pack top and a single blade throttle body. Ported and port matched of course.

Update on the intake manifold, we have decided to use a GenV plastic intake with 2 (possibly 70 mm ) mechanical throttle bodies. Justin @ JMB will be doing the custom work to make the throttle bodies work. Being ordered today. Greg Good is about 2-3 weeks from finishing the heads, still trying to get to 380 cfm on the intake, and he will do some minor work on the plastic intake (port match, etc, possibly some porting also, but being careful with the plastic) after Justin is done.
